How We Assess Gardens

The NZGT has two categories of gardens:           

  1. Registered Garden
  2. Garden of Significance

 

Registered Garden 

 

These are gardens that have been visited by the NZGT to ensure that the information we publish on our website is true and correct.  You can be confident that the information on this website describes each garden accurately.

 

Some of our 'Registered Gardens' will surprise you with their quality and standard, with many excellent gardens listed under this category.

 

Garden of Significance

 

These gardens have been critically evaluated by two professional assessors. The assessors consider a range of factors before determining the final outcome.  These areas include (in broad terms):

  • Hard landscape and design
  • Plant material and use
  • Maintenance
  • Safety
  • Overall impression

The 'pass mark' has been set very high for these gardens, so the visitor should be in no doubt of their quality.  We believe that a Garden of Significance is up with the best in the world, and is a garden not to be missed if you get the opportunity.
